About

Marisa Iborra is a scholar working on Genetics, Epidemiology and Surgery. According to data from OpenAlex, Marisa Iborra has authored 23 papers receiving a total of 282 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Genetics, 11 papers in Epidemiology and 7 papers in Surgery. Recurrent topics in Marisa Iborra's work include Inflammatory Bowel Disease (16 papers), Microscopic Colitis (9 papers) and Acute Lymphoblastic Leukemia research (4 papers). Marisa Iborra is often cited by papers focused on Inflammatory Bowel Disease (16 papers), Microscopic Colitis (9 papers) and Acute Lymphoblastic Leukemia research (4 papers). Marisa Iborra collaborates with scholars based in Spain and United States. Marisa Iborra's co-authors include Eva Sesé, José Castellote, Antonia Perelló, Xavier Xiol, Josep M. Simón Castellví, Jordi Guardiola, Pilar Nos, Belén Beltrán, Guillermo Bastida and Vicente Garrigues and has published in prestigious journals such as Gastroenterology, Hepatology and Scientific Reports.
